你找錯文了
這篇翻出來意思是
歐洲食品安全局的科學家發表一個聲明,歐洲成人攝取受汙染奶粉製成的巧克力和餅
乾,就算在最壞的情況下也不至於超過一天的安全容許量:每公斤體重0.5毫克[*2]
(每天每公斤體重0.5毫克的觀念和0.5ppm不一樣,它意思是如果是60公斤重的成人,
每天可以容許30毫克的攝取量,和0.5ppm並沒有關係)
[*2]內容則是歐洲食品安全局所謂最壞的情況是根據中國報告中嬰兒奶粉2500ppm的
三聚氰胺濃度,攝取量以在第95百分位的量當做基準
你引的新聞和聯合報報導的基本上是不同的兩件事
這篇才是聯合報報導的:
http://www.food.gov.uk/news/newsarchive/2008/sep/melamine
All products from China containing more than 15% milk as an ingredient, or
products where the percentage of milk content cannot be established, will be
subject to documentary, identity and physical checks, including laboratory
analysis, to determine that any levels of melamine present in the product do
not exceed 2.5 mg/kg. Those products with more than 2.5mg/kg will be
destroyed.

> EFSA assesses possible risks related to melamine in composite foods from China
> 25/09/2008
> Following recent events in China, the European Commission asked the European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) to provide urgent scientific advice on health risks for European consumers related to the possible presence of melamine[1] in composite
foods
> containing milk or milk products originating from China.
> EFSA’s scientists today issued a statement saying that if adults in Europe were to consume chocolates and biscuits containing contaminated milk powder, they would not exceed the TDI (Tolerable Daily Intake) of 0.5 mg/kg body weight, even in
worst case
> scenarios[2].
> Children with a mean consumption of biscuits, milk toffee and chocolate made with such milk powder would also not exceed the TDI. However, in worst case scenarios with the highest level of contamination, children with high daily consumption o
f milk
> toffee, chocolate or biscuits containing high levels of milk powder would exceed the TDI. Children who consume both such biscuits and chocolate could potentially exceed the TDI by up to more than three times.
> High levels of melamine can primarily affect the kidneys. EFSA applied the TDI of 0.5 mg/kg body weight for melamine in a specific case of contamination in 2007[3].
> The Commission requested EFSA to focus its assessment on biscuits and chocolate which contain milk powder as such products can be imported from China. EFSA developed theoretical exposure scenarios based on European consumption figures[4] of b
iscuits and
> chocolate. In the absence of available data for contaminated milk powder, EFSA also used the highest value of melamine, reported in Chinese infant formula as a basis for worst case scenarios. EFSA stressed that it is not known at the moment w
hether such
> theoretical high level exposure scenarios could occur in Europe.
